One of many to start with and nevertheless greatest hardstyle events is Qlimax. The initial took place in Eidhoven (June 2000), accompanied by three events in 2001 and given that 2003 Qlimax is definitely an once-a-year occasion at the GelreDome in Arnhem, Netherland. Each and every celebration is held about a concept, having a substantial focus on The sunshine show.

The controversy more than riddim is essentially a tale as previous as time - the battle between the outdated and The brand new. Largely, the controversy surrounding riddim as a subgenre relies over the belief that it isn’t a subgenre in the least, but relatively, a return to earlier kinds of dubstep. Much of the issue surrounds the fact that newcomers for Dubstep the scene may very well be inclined to “obtain” riddim and Assume it’s a thing new because they are unfamiliar with earlier Appears with the subgenre. Dubstep purists and people who will not see riddim to be a subgenre feel that it should really simply just be called “dubstep.” Dubstep started to consider off in America within the early 2010s with the release of Skrillex’s EP, Terrifying Monsters and Great Sprites.

During the latter 50 percent in the 2010s, melodic riddim started to gain notoriety by using audio producers like Chime and Ace Aura.[twelve] Melodic riddim is really a subgenre of riddim that contains far more melodic qualities, crystalline or liquid textures, and dazzling manufacturing. It focuses more about the melody, like typical melodic dubstep, but the synths, while aquiring a melody, are often a little bit aggressive and detuned.[thirteen] Like other varieties of riddim, melodic riddim also incorporates a kick in addition to a clap as an alternative to one snare.
